Job Description
Position: Full Stack Developer / Software Engineer
About Us
Gislen Software is an Indian-Swedish software development company based in Chennai, India. We deliver high-quality software development services primarily to clients in Sweden and the UK. Our focus areas include bespoke software development, systems integration, analytics and AI, and e-commerce applications.
We are now looking for an experienced Full Stack Developer / Software Engineer with 1.5 3 years of hands-on experience in both backend and frontend technologies to join our growing team. The ideal candidate is someone who thrives in a collaborative environment, enjoys solving complex problems, and takes ownership of delivering clean, efficient, and scalable software solutions.
Your Role
In this full-time role, you will design, develop, and maintain web-based software applications from end to end - from crafting robust backends using .NET Core to building intuitive frontends using React or Angular. You will collaborate closely with clients, project managers, and cross-functional teams to ensure every product meets both technical and business needs.
Key Responsibilities
- Design, develop, and maintain scalable web applications using .NET Framework / .NET Core for the backend.
- Build dynamic, responsive, and user-friendly interfaces using React, Angular, or similar frameworks.
- Write efficient, reusable, and testable code while maintaining coding standards and best practices.
- Design and manage relational databases using SQL; optimise queries and ensure data integrity.
- Develop and consume RESTful APIs for seamless system integration.
- Participate in all stages of the software development lifecycle, including design, implementation, testing, and deployment.
- Write and maintain unit tests to ensure code quality and reliability.
- Collaborate within Agile/Scrum teams to plan, deliver, and continuously improve development processes.
- Conduct code reviews, troubleshoot issues, and optimise application performance.
- Communicate effectively with international clients and team members to clarify requirements and provide progress updates.
Required Skills
- 1.5 3 years of professional experience as a Full Stack Developer or Software Engineer.
- Strong hands-on expertise with .NET Framework / .NET Core for backend development.
- Solid frontend development skills in React, Angular, or similar JavaScript frameworks.
- Good understanding of SQL, database design, and relational data modelling.
- Working knowledge of unit testing frameworks and test-driven development practices.
- Familiarity with RESTful APIs, Git, and Agile/Scrum methodologies.
- Excellent verbal and written communication skills in English.
- A proactive, ownership-driven attitude with strong problem-solving and analytical abilities.
- Ability to debug, troubleshoot, and deliver solutions with minimal supervision.
Nice-to-Have Skills
- Experience with CI/CD pipelines and build automation tools.
- Exposure to Azure or other cloud environments (AWS, GCP).
- Understanding of DevOps practices and containerisation (Docker/Kubernetes).
- Familiarity with microservices architecture and distributed systems.
What We Offer
- Opportunity to work with a multicultural, international team delivering high-impact projects.
- A culture that values personal care, learning, and continuous improvement.
- Exposure to the full software lifecycle - from concept to deployment.
- Supportive environment encouraging innovation, autonomy, and professional growth.
- Competitive salary and performance-based incentives.
- Hybrid working flexibility and opportunities to collaborate with clients in Europe.
Performance Expectations and Evaluations
- Writing clean, maintainable, and high-performance code.
- Delivering quality features on time with proper documentation.
- Active participation in sprint planning, stand-ups, and retrospectives.
- Collaboration with team members to identify, analyse, and resolve issues.
- Demonstrating initiative and ownership in improving project quality and delivery.
- Weekly and monthly performance reviews
- 3-month evaluation to assess effectiveness and long-term fit
How to Apply
If you're a motivated developer who enjoys full-stack challenges and values working in a global, quality-driven environment, we'd love to hear from you!
Please send your CV and a brief cover letter explaining why you're a good fit for this role to [Confidential Information].